In 1946-47, I enjoyed many a Saturday matinee at the Idle Hour Theater located on the north side of Plymouth Road west of Greenfield.

I have no records of an Idle Hour Theatre in Detroit. There is no theatre by this name in any Film Daily Yearbooks that I have (between 1941 and 1950), nor is there a theatre by this name in the Stuart Galbraith IV book “Motor City Marquees”.

I do however see there was the Atlas Theatre, 15832 Plymouth Road, Detroit, which maps out 3 blocks west of Greenfield Avenue. The Atlas Theatre, opened in 1939 and has its own page listing on Cinema Treasures.

There was an Idle hour theatre on W.Vernor (4435 W.Vernor) that opened in 1909 as Smith’s theatre, was renamed the Idle hour in 1911 and closed in 1912.
